Summary

The LOTUS Study is intended to demonstrate the usability of the MICHI Neuroprotection System (MICHI NPS) or MICHI Neuroprotection System with filter (MICHI NPS+f) for use in subjects who are candidates for Carotid Artery Stenting (CAS). It is a prospective, single arm study in which a maximum of 30 study subjects, and a run-in enrollment of up to 10 subjects will be followed immediately post-op and at 30 days.

Detailed description

Cerebral embolization during carotid artery stenting (CAS) can often precipitate severe adverse neurological effects. Most major clinical studies of CAS have used distal filters for cerebral protection and have compared the neurologic complication rates with those of carotid endarterectomy (CEA). Many currently available embolic protection devices, however, have limited efficacy in capturing microembolic debris liberated during stenting, pre-dilatation and post-dilatation. Furthermore, distal protection systems are limited by the need to cross the lesion prior to deployment. Some studies have shown a relatively high incidence of cerebral infarction even when distal protection devices are employed. Cerebral protection with carotid flow reversal is a method that was developed by Parodi, et al. (2005), as an alternative to the use of distal protection devices. While novel in its approach, this method too has its limitations. Criado, et al. (2004), developed a derivative technique that employs carotid flow reversal prior to traversing the stenosis that can be accomplished by directly accessing carotid anatomy without the use of the transfemoral approach. Major benefits to this method include the ability to perform the procedure on patients with severe carotid tortuosity and difficult aortic arch anatomy.
